Many people don’t know where the spermatic cord is. In fact, the area from the male’s inguinal groove to the upper end of the testicle is called the spermatic cord. This area includes many things, such as the male vas deferens, the testicular artery, etc. Men may have many problems in the spermatic cord, such as the well-known spermatic cord cyst. In addition, some people may have widened spermatic veins. So what causes this symptom? What causes widening of the left spermatic vein? Consider the possibility of varicocele. Mild varicocele has no obvious symptoms and sometimes manifests as bloating and pain in the groin area. Moderate to severe varicocele can cause increased scrotal skin temperature, affecting sperm production and vitality, and is a common cause of male infertility. Varicocele refers to the obstruction of the venous return of the spermatic cord, valve failure, blood reflux and blood stagnation, resulting in dilation, elongation and bending of the varicocele.
